Certifications & Ratings
- Product warranty: RA2 Select and RadioRA 3: 2 years after date of shipment by Lutron. HomeWorks QS and HomeWorks: Up to 2 years – 100%; more than 2 years, but not more than 5 years – 50%; more than 5 years, but not more than 8 years – 25%; more than 8 years – 0%. These warranty periods only cover residential applications. To the maximum extent permitted by applicable law, if this product is installed in a commercial application, the warranty period is limited to 2 years.

The Lutron Vive PowPak Relay Module is a wireless lighting control relay from Lutron's Vive range. Identified by model RMJS-16R-DV-B, the unit is designed to switch and control lighting loads remotely using radio frequency communication within the Vive ecosystem.
Form follows function: the module is housed in a compact, white rectangular plastic enclosure with a low-profile footprint so it can be concealed within or mounted on standard electrical infrastructure. The Vive branding and bright green label identify it as part of Lutron's wireless control family.
Build details are straightforward and installer-focused. A threaded white plastic nipple at the top allows secure insertion into standard junction-box knockouts, while a wiring harness with pre-stripped black, blue and white leads exits the top for straightforward connection. The front face carries two small push-buttons and matching LED indicators for local control and status feedback.
In use the PowPak serves as a relay to switch lighting loads under radio control, with local manual buttons for on-site operation and programming. LED indicators give visual feedback for power, communication and programming modes so installers can confirm status during setup.
Installation notes: the nipple design supports tool-less insertion into common electrical boxes and the pre-stripped leads speed wiring. The model number is printed on the label for clear identification; consult Lutron documentation for load compatibility, dimming method and system integration. About Lutron Lighting
Lutron is an American lighting-control specialist whose Vive range focuses on simple, reliable wireless control for commercial and residential interiors. The PowPaks compact, modular form reflects Lutrons engineering-led approach: discreet enclosures designed to sit within existing electrical infrastructure, clear labelling for installers and purposeful control interfaces. Known for system interoperability and professional support, Lutron products are specified where considered, long-term performance and precise control are required.
